Forest pair fire back in reserves

Nottingham Forest's Paul Anderson and Lewis McGugan both scored in the Reds' 7-1 reserve win over Walsall.

The midfielders, who are both recovering from injuries, got vital match action in Tuesday's game.

Reserve coach John Pemberton told the club website: "Paul looked sharp and looks like he is chomping at the bit, so we're really pleased with him.

"It was Lewis' first game in a long time and he needs to play a bit more but is going in the right direction."

Anderson will now wait to see if he is in the Reds side for QPR on Saturday.

It is thought McGugan, who came on as a substitute for Anderson, will play another reserve match before being considered for first-team action.

The 19-year-old has missed the last nine matches for the Reds due to a thigh injury.
